Output f55c38e51c27d5621811d2c87929d78684d83e4ba61f8d3e76cb869283859c52:6

value
24987083
script pubkey
OP_0 OP_PUSHBYTES_20 87d1b3433b971395909bca404773ee4b73031faf
address
bc1qslgmxsemjufetyymefqywulwfdesx8a038rflt
transaction
f55c38e51c27d5621811d2c87929d78684d83e4ba61f8d3e76cb869283859c52
spent
true